1. What are Storm Windows?
Storm windows are windows that are installed on the exterior or interior of your existing windows. They are designed to provide an extra layer of protection against the elements, helping to keep your home more comfortable and energy-efficient. Storm windows come in a variety of materials, including aluminum, vinyl, and wood, so you can choose the option that best suits your home and budget.
2. How Do Storm Windows Improve Air Quality?
Storm windows help to improve air quality in your home by creating a barrier against outdoor pollutants like dust, pollen, and other airborne particles. By keeping these pollutants out, storm windows can help to reduce allergens in your home and create a healthier indoor environment for you and your family.
3. Benefits of Storm Windows for Better Air Quality
There are several benefits to installing storm windows in your home to improve air quality, including:
-Reduced allergens: By keeping outdoor pollutants out, storm windows can help to reduce allergens in your home, making it easier for you and your family to breathe.
-Energy efficiency: Storm windows provide an extra layer of insulation for your home, helping to keep heat in during the winter and out during the summer. This can help you save on energy costs and reduce your carbon footprint.
-Improved comfort: Storm windows can help to reduce drafts and cold spots in your home, making it more comfortable year-round.
-Noise reduction: In addition to improving air quality, storm windows can also help to reduce noise pollution from outside, creating a quieter and more peaceful indoor environment.
4. How to Choose the Right Storm Windows for Your Home
When choosing storm windows for your home, there are a few factors to consider:
-Material: Consider the material of the storm windows and choose the option that best suits your home’s aesthetic and budget.
-Installation: Decide whether you want to install storm windows on the exterior or interior of your existing windows.
-Functionality: Determine what features are most important to you, such as energy efficiency, noise reduction, or UV protection.
-Budget: Set a budget for your storm window installation and shop around for the best options within your price range.
5. How to Install Storm Windows
Installing storm windows is a relatively simple process that can be done by a professional or as a DIY project. Here are a few steps to follow when installing storm windows:
-Measure your existing windows to ensure you choose the right size storm windows.
-Remove any existing screens or storm windows from your windows.
-Install the storm windows according to the manufacturer’s instructions, making sure they are securely in place.
-Seal any gaps or cracks around the edges of the storm windows to ensure they are airtight.
